Students motivation for adopting programming contests: Innovation-diffusion perspective.
Raghu RamanHardik VachharajaniKrishnashree AchuthanPublished in: Educ. Inf. Technol. (2018)
Keyphrases
- programming course
- computer programming
- student motivation
- programming concepts
- programming education
- introductory programming
- elementary students
- novice programmers
- student learning
- life long learning
- introductory computer science
- learning experience
- learning outcomes
- high school
- learning environment
- programming skills
- higher education
- innovation diffusion
- english learning
- learning activities
- distance learning
- intrinsic motivation
- computer science education
- e learning
- programming environment
- high school students
- programming assignments
- lego mindstorms
- computer assisted instruction
- undergraduate students
- individual differences
- introductory programming courses
- college students
- learning achievement
- programming environments
- computer science curriculum
- programming language
- intelligent tutoring systems
- distance education
- online course
- computer programs
- cooperative learning
- problem based learning
- tutoring system
- science education
- intelligent tutor
- video games
- multiple perspectives
- collaborative learning
- motivational factors
- learning process
- online learning
- learning computer programming
- instructional strategies
- computer science
- students completed
- computer software
- source code
- descriptive statistics
- instructional materials
- cognitive tutor
- automatic assessment